Our legal team has demonstrated exceptional performance and innovation in the past year, advising on some of the most complex and impactful PPP projects across the globe. Two key examples:

Advising Transport Infrastructure Ireland (TII) on the Dublin Metrolink project, providing comprehensive legal support across procurement, contracts, sustainability, and finance strategies for Ireland's largest civil engineering project, which includes a high-capacity metro system connecting key areas in Dublin. Our work also focuses on climate and sustainability, ensuring alignment with the EU Taxonomy, supporting sustainable financing, and meeting EU regulatory requirements for corporate sustainability reporting and due diligence.

Advising a consortium of major banks on the multibillion-dollar financing of NEOM residential communities, a significant public-private partnership project involving Islamic financing to develop housing and facilities for 10,000 people across five communities in Saudi Arabia.
